Before he became the nations favourite Mammy Brendan OCarroll was known simply as Brendan. The youngest of ten children from a poor family in Dublin Brendan left school at the mere age of 12 to begin what would become a long and varied working life. He would go on to be a waiter a publican a window cleaner and a publisher amongst other jobs. Throughout the tough moments Brendan always had humour and a good story to tell alongside the everguiding inspiration of his own Mammy a formidable figure who became Irelands first female Labour MP. His hope and determination meant he never gave up and eventually a chance opportunity to perform standup would pave the way for the TV show that would become Mrs. Browns Boys. In his own unique voice Brendan OCarroll strings together the threads of his life a helterskelter story tracing the helterskelter journey of a scrawny kid from Finglas Dublin to TV screens around the world told with warmth humour a touch of mischievousness and more than a few coincidences.
